    Captain Marvel #12 Apr 1969
    "The Moment of--the Man-Slayer!"
    The issue begins with Mar-Vell receiving an insurmountable amount of new powers from the being named ZO.
    In exchange for his new abilities, Mar-Vell has agreed to serve ZO once he has gained his revenge on Yon-Rogg.
    Mar-Vell streaks through space to track down the starship Helion on which Yon-Rogg is based.
    However he first takes a detour to the asteroid where he had buried his love Una.
    After paying his respects, the Man of Kree plans on how best to make Yon-Rogg suffer for his crimes, rather than giving him a swift death.
    At the same time, Yon-Rogg wakes up screaming as he feels Captain Mar-Vell staring at him,
    but the Colonel convinces himself that his foe is surely dead and he was merely having a nightmare.

    Mar-Vell uses his new teleportation ability to head back to his hotel room in Florida.
    However he miscalculates the location and ends up in a Communist Latin American country.
    Before he is captured by soldiers, Mar-Vell once again teleports and this time reaches the hotel.

    A newspaper inside his room shows Mar-Vell his Earth identity, Dr. Walter Lawson, has been reported AWOL from duty at The Cape military base.
    Meantime General Bridges informs The Cape’s Head of Security, Carol Danvers,
    that Captain Marvel is to be shot on site and gives her permission to arrest Dr. Lawson.

    Elsewhere in a Caribbean military base, Black Widow is on a mission on orders from Nick Fury.
    Within the base a figure sits in a control room watching as his android creation, The Manslayer, approaches The Cape.

    Walter Lawson arrives at The Cape and is immediately arrested when suddenly The Manslyer strikes.
    Whilst the soldiers are distracted, Lawson creates the illusion of a protest group
    and disappears in the confusion to change into Captain Marvel.
    Meantime Black Widow attempts to capture the man at the controls but is captured herself by more Manslayers.
    The android at The Cape is ordered to destroy a new rocket when Captain Marvel strikes.
    A battle ensues and The Manslayer eventually defeats Captain Marvel – even with his new found powers.
    While the android is about to strike his final blow, he suddenly freezes up as Black Widow had managed
    to destroy his energy source at the Caribbean base, getting knocked unconscious with nerve gas soon after.
    Meanwhile, Mar-Vell used The Manslayer's inactivity to change back into "Walter Lawson" and when the soldiers try to arrest him,

    he uses his illusion casting powers to make himself appear invisible so that he can escape.

    Script by Arnold Drake, pencils by Dick Ayers, inks by Syd Shores

    Ms. Marvel 23 Apr 1979
    "The Woman Who Fell to Earth"
    After a date with Sam Adams, Carol Danvers returns home to relax,

    when she is suddenly visited by Salia Petrie, whom she thought had died in space.

    However, after putting her to rest in her apartment, Carol is attacked by Salia who transports Carol to
    the Guardians of the Galaxy's space station which is under the control of the Faceless One
    who saved Salia in order to get to and take control of Ms. Marvel.

    Getting away from the Faceless One, Carol finds Vance Astro who helps her battle the Faceless One to try and free Salia.
    During the battle, Carol destroys the Faceless One's android body with freezing coolant,
    and the two manage to defeat the Faceless One. Afterwords, Vance uses his mental powers to free
    Salia from the Faceless One's control. After which Carol reveals her identity to the frightened Salia.

    Chris Claremont script. Mike Vosburg & Bruce Patterson art.

    Avengers #242 Apr 1984
    "Easy Come...Easy Go!"
    Let the good times roll at Avengers Mansion! After completing their west coast adventure,

    the Avengers return home and throw a party for the newlyweds, Hawkeye and Mockingbird!

    And the celebration becomes even more joyous when the Vision finally regains full use of his synthetic body!
    But several minutes later, the Vision detects a massive energy source in Central Park!
    Earth's Mightiest Heroes run across the street to investigate and discover an enormous citadel!
    Six avengers including Captain America, Captain Marvel, Hawkeye, She-Hulk, Thor and the Wasp rush inside the mammoth structure...

    and suddenly disappear! Where did they go?

    Script by Roger Stern. Art by Al Milgrom (breakdowns), Joe Rubinstein (finishes) and Brett Breeding (finishes).

    Starblast #4 Apr 1994
    Starblast Crossover: Part 12 of 12 "The End of the World (As We Know It)"
    It's the final showdown between the Stranger and Skeletron for the fate of the Starbrand.


    The Starblasters find themselves trapped in the New Universe,

    while the Stranger transports his planet, the New Universe's Earth and all the heroes involved, to our Universe.

    Featuring: Black Bolt, Lockjaw, Captain Marvel, Binary, Ikaris, Perun and the Stranger.

    Written by Mark Gruenwald. Pencils by Kong, Palant & Buckler Jr.. Inks by Don Hudson & Ernie Chan.
